Introduction to Cryptocurrency Portfolio Management

What is Cryptocurrency Portfolio Management?

Cryptocurrency portfolio management involves the strategic allocation, tracking, and optimization of digital assets to achieve specific financial goals. It includes monitoring market trends, analyzing volatility, and rebalancing portfolios to mitigate risks. Tools for this purpose range from simple tracking apps to advanced trading platforms with integrated analytics.
